10. Rights of the Data Subject
As a data subject, you may exercise the rights referred to in Articles 15–22 GDPR, including access, rectification, erasure, restriction, portability, objection, as well as lodging a complaint with the Data Protection Authority. In particular, under Art. 15 GDPR, you have the right to obtain:- confirmation of whether your data are being processed and access to such Data and information on purposes, categories, recipients, retention period/criteria, rights, source of the Data, existence of automated decision-making (profiling), and related logic/consequences;
- information on safeguards adopted in the event of transfers to third countries/international organizations (Art. 46 GDPR);
- a copy of the Data being processed (any additional copies may incur a reasonable administrative fee). If the request is made electronically, the response will be provided in a commonly used electronic format, unless otherwise requested.
